Curtin, Suzanne – Journal of Child Language, 2009
Infants at 1;2 demonstrate difficulty in accessing subtle phonetic information about newly learned word-object pairings (Stager & Werker, 1997). In this study, we examined whether or not infants can access subtle prosodic information such as lexical stress in a word learning task.
